Brian Walker

10 books

809 pages first pub 2009 (editions)

nonfiction science challenging informative reflective slow-paced

192 pages first pub 2006 (editions)

nonfiction science challenging informative reflective slow-paced

224 pages first pub 2010 (editions)

missing page info first pub 1988 (editions)

lighthearted medium-paced

280 pages first pub 2010 (editions)

adventurous funny lighthearted slow-paced

120 pages first pub 2007 (editions)

224 pages missing pub info (editions)

missing page info first pub 2023 (editions)

56 pages missing pub info (editions)

nonfiction art historical poetry

missing page info missing pub info (editions)